A one and one-half inch outer diameter stainless steel handrail terminates at a structural steel channel supported by a three-sixteenths by two-inch steel plate. One-half-inch steel rod pickets are spaced typically along the assembly and welded to the steel plate. All interior exposed steel except the handrail is primed and painted. Welds at the handrail termination are continuously applied to the rod pickets and ground smooth.
